US Senator Bernie Sanders has proposed price caps on drugs developed with federal funds from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) or the Biomedical Advanced Research and Development Authority (BARDA), following a political career battling against high drug prices. Given that big pharma is already challenging price cuts in the Inflation Reduction Act, even if Sanders’s legislation passes, it may not be successfully implemented in the face of legal opposition from the industry.
Sanders’s proposed bill could be another hit on the profitability of US drugs following the Inflation Reduction Act of August 2022, which aims to lower prescription drug prices by setting prices for medicines covered by Medicare. The trade organization PhRMA claims that lowering drug prices will discourage innovative drug development.
